Scores per pillar

Nature scores 7.1 in Limmel, eastern Maastricht — the highest of its five pillars, against a social cohesion score of just 2.7. The overall grade lands at 3.1, ranking 11,994th out of 13,064 neighbourhoods. Income per resident of €23,000 is the lowest in this batch, at 33 per cent owner-occupied. With 67 per cent single-person households and 34.1 crimes per 1,000 people present against a median of 24, safety scores 4.3. Housing, at 3.2, is similarly weak.

Frequently asked questions

How is the grade for Limmel calculated?

Limmel scores 3.1 overall. That is a weighted average of five pillars: safety, amenities, housing, social & income, and nature & quiet. Each pillar compares this neighbourhood with every other neighbourhood in the Netherlands, using open data from CBS and the police.

Is Limmel a safe neighbourhood?

Limmel scores 4.3 on safety, based on registered crimes per 1,000 people present (34.1 per year). The national median is around 24.1.
